Table 6.12 ICE-IRB Relay Board
Signal (Left Edge)
Signal (Right Edge)
BD:
Brake Driver relay indicator. When the BD relay on
the Relay board is closed to pick the brake, this LED
will light. Monitored by Safety Processor A.
M1:
Drive contactor coil connection.
TB:
Brake Triac active indicator. When the brake triac
on the Relay board is active (completes circuit for BD
relay), this LED will light. Monitored by Safety Proces-
sor B.
M2:
Drive contactor coil connection.
BRD:
Brake Redundancy. This LED lights when the
main brake contactor drops out.
MR:
Connects to drive contactor auxiliary contact
for redundancy input.
BDRD:
Brake Drive Redundancy. This LED lights when
the BD relay drops out.
MX:
Connects to drive contactor auxiliary contact
for brake qualification.
MD:
Motor Drive relay indicator. When the MD relay on
the Relay board is closed to enable the motor, this LED
will light. Monitored by Safety Processor A.
M:
Part of MX circuit.
TM:
Motor Triac active indicator. When the motor triac
on the Relay board is active (completes circuit for MD
relay), this LED will light. Monitored by Safety Proces-
sor B.
UP:
Up direction output to MCE System 12 SCR
Drive.
MRD:
Motor Redundancy. This LED lights when the
main motor contactor drops out.
DN:
Down direction output to MCE System 12
SCR Drive.
MDRD:
Motor Drive Redundancy. This LED lights when
the MD relay drops out.
_ _:
Not connected.
SAFC:
Safety Cartop input. Cartop safety relays and
switches are wired in series between SAFH (Safety
Hoistway) and SAFC. If any contact in the safety string
opens, there will be 0VDC on this input and the car will
not run. If all safety contacts in the string are closed,
there will be 110VDC on this input.
2D:
120VAC power to the drive. Fused on IRB
board (fuse F2D).
SAFH:
Safety Hoistway input. Hoistway safety relays
and switches are wired in series between the #3 bus
and SAFH. The patch also includes the Governor
switch, with the GOV connection providing access to
the #3 bus via the governor switch. (#3 to GOV
through governor switch, GOV to SAFH through hoist-
way safety relays and switches). The job prints for the
job provide specific wiring instructions. If any contact
in the safety string opens, there will be 0VDC on this
input and the car will not run. If all safety contacts in
the string are closed, there will be 110VDC on this
input.
1D:
System common to the drive - source is the
1 bus.
SP1 D
: Optional input. See job prints.
BK2:
Connects to the brake contactor for redun-
dancy checking. The source of power for this cir-
cuit comes from fuse F2 on the IRB board.
SP2 D
: Optional input. See job prints. (When used as
a brake pick switch input: Set brake = 110VDC. Picked
brake = 0VDC.
BK1:
Connects to the brake contactor for redun-
dancy checking. The source of power for this cir-
cuit comes from fuse F2 on the IRB board.
SP2:
Optional input. See job prints.
BC1:
Connects to the brake contactor coil (see
job prints for connection).
SP3:
Optional input. See job prints.
BC2:
Connects to the brake contactor coil (see
job prints for connection).
